Abstract

A system includes a sensor device for monitoring properties of a building material within which the sensor device can be embedded. The sensor device includes a controller, a memory associated with the controller, one or more sensors communicatively connected to the controller for measuring one or more properties of the building material, and a power supply for powering components of the sensor device. The power supply includes a battery and a power regulator. The sensor device includes communications circuitry connected to the controller, where the controller is configured to receive data on the one or more properties of the building material from the one or more sensors after the sensor device is embedded into the building material. The communications circuitry wirelessly transmits the data on the one or more properties to a cloud-based computing system via a cellular transmission.

Claims (13)

1 . A system, comprising:

a sensor device configured to be embedded in a building material,

the sensor device comprising:

communications circuitry including a near-field communications interface configured to receive an activation signal from a computing device external to the building material:

a power management subcircuit having an input electrically coupled to the communications circuitry to receive the activation signal and an output electrically coupled to a power regulator, the power management subcircuit being configured to enable the power regulator in response to the activation signal;

the power regulator having an input electrically coupled to the output of the power management subcircuit and an output configured to provide regulated electrical power;

a microcontroller unit having a power input electrically coupled to the output of the power regulator;

one or more sensing components electrically coupled to the microcontroller unit and configured to measure one or more properties of the building material;

nonvolatile memory electrically coupled to the microcontroller unit and configured to store data representing the measured one or more properties; and

wherein the microcontroller unit is configured to receive measurement data from the sensing components, store the measurement data in the nonvolatile memory, and control the communications circuitry to wirelessly transmit the stored measurement data to at least one of the computing device and a cloud-based computing system.

2 . The system of claim 1 , wherein the building material comprises concrete, asphalt, or epoxy.

3 . The system of claim 1 , wherein the one or more properties comprise building material strength, relative humidity, temperature, vibration, pH, gas and particle presence, load, and/or acoustic properties.

4 . The system of claim 1 , wherein the sensor device communicates with the cloud-based computing system using high speed packet access [HSPA], HSPA+, long term evolution [LTE], WiMax, near field communications (NFC), Bluetooth, personal area networks (PANs), NB-IOT, DR-Plus, or CAT-M1.
